# Setting up Power BI and Integrating it With Microsoft Dynamics 365 Owner: Savage Babajide Author: Savage Babajide Category: Power BI Created time: September 2, 2024 4:34 AM Publish: Yes **STEP 1 - Download Power BI Desktop** You can download on Microsoft Store or use [Power BI Desktop Download Link](https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/power-platform/products/power-bi/desktop) ![power-bi-start.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/power-bi-start.png) **STEP 2 - LOGIN** First thing you need to do is sign-in your Dynamics Account. Click on sign-in, type in your Dynamics username, then click on continue. 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image.png) After signing in, you’ll see your username at the/ top right corner of your Power BI home screen 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%201.png) **STEP 3 - CONFIGURE THE IMPORT SETTINGS** Before you start importing your data, there are some usual things to check and configure - Click on File 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%202.png) - Click on Options and Settings, then click on Options 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%203.png) - In the **Current File** section, click on **Data Load**, ****I’ll advice turning off those two settings. Those settings automatically detect relationships when you load in your data and can sometimes undo customizations you have performed, so they are best left off. 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%204.png) **STEP 4** - **Make sure your Dataverse in Microsoft Dynamics 365 is enabled for Power BI** Go to [Home - Power Platform admin center (microsoft.com)](https://admin.powerplatform.microsoft.com/home) to get to the admin side of Microsoft Power Platform, click on **Environments**, select your environment and click on **Settings.** 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%205.png) - Click on Product and click on Features 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%206.png) - Ensure **TDS Endpoint** is enabled 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%207.png) STEP 5 - GET DATA To get your data into Power BI report, click on **Get data,** select more at the bottom, search for **Dataverse**, after selecting **Dataverse,** click on **continue.** 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%208.png) - You get a Pop-up prompting you to sign-in, click on sign-in 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%209.png) - Input your sign-in credentials. 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%2010.png) - Note, when you are done with the sign-in, you’ll be able to see that on the screen, Click on **Connect.** 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%2011.png) - This Navigator pane shows up, expand the environment you want to get tables from, select the tables and click on **Load**, should you want to do some data manipulation, then click on Transform Data, this opens up Power Query editor. 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%2012.png) - After Loading your data into Power BI, navigate to the Model view in Power BI and setup your relationship. ![image.png](Setting%20up%20Power%20BI%20and%20Integrating%20it%20With%20Micros%2051a141da344e47e5aa3c54f4b730e906/image%2013.png) ### *START BUILDING YOUR REPORT!!!*
